Most country kitchen decor focuses on the utilize of natural materials, obviously because there weren’t the new man-made materials around in the era of early rural life.
The rustic charm of country kitchen decor begins with the walls of the kitchen. You want these to be made from natural material like rough bricks, or wood or if the walls are made from plaster, you want them painted in a neutral earthy color.
The floors of country style kitchens are usually made from wood or some have professionally laid brickwork which really adds a lot of authenticity to the see of the kitchen. You could also exercise tiles with a matt accomplish in rich earthy colors.
The ceiling of the kitchen is usually famed by big commence beams and a country kitchen wouldn’t be complete without a bricked fireplace.
Country kitchen decor includes the utilize of start shelves, with cabinets and buffets made from wood that is roughly finished. These are filled with stoneware and earthenware plates, dishes and jugs.
Pots were usually made of cast iron or copper and were usually kept on the fire stove, so you want to include these items in your country theme. Using weaved baskets for storage also adds a nice touch.
The kitchen always had a mountainous wooden table as the centrepiece. Here vegetables for the evening meal were peeled and prepared, meals were eaten and family members gathered together. The kitchen was the hub of the home, as it serene appears to be these days.
The table was always heavy, solid, and roughly finished wood, with solid wooden roughly hewed chairs to match. It was simply decorated with maybe a jug of freshly picked meadow flowers.
